What to Include in an Inventory Stocker Resume

Your resume as an Inventory Stocker should reflect both your technical skills and your ability to work efficiently in a fast-paced environment. The primary goal is to showcase your skills in inventory management, organization, attention to detail, and the ability to work with various tools and equipment. Below, we’ll walk through the key sections of your resume to help you get noticed.

1. Contact Information

Your contact information should be at the top of your resume, including your full name, phone number, email address, and location. While it’s not mandatory to include your full address, adding your city and state is a good idea so employers know where you are located. Make sure your email is professional, ideally something simple like your name or a variation of it.

2. Professional Summary

In the professional summary, highlight your experience in inventory stocking, your knowledge of warehouse operations, and any relevant skills you bring to the table. This section should be concise but compelling, grabbing the employer’s attention right away. For example:

Professional Summary:
Highly organized and detail-oriented Inventory Stocker with over 3 years of experience in managing inventory levels, organizing stockrooms, and ensuring accurate order fulfillment. Proven ability to maintain a smooth workflow and improve operational efficiency. Adept at using warehouse management systems and performing stock audits with precision. Strong team player with excellent problem-solving skills and a commitment to safety.

4. Work Experience

Your work experience section should detail your previous roles in inventory management, stocker positions, or similar fields. Be sure to highlight any accomplishments that show how you contributed to the company’s success. Use bullet points to keep it organized and make it easy for employers to read.

Work Experience:

Inventory Stocker | ABC Warehouse | January 2022 – Present
- Efficiently stocked shelves and ensured inventory was accurately recorded and tracked.
- Conducted regular stock audits, reducing discrepancies by 15%.
- Assisted in organizing the warehouse layout for easy access to products, improving pick times by 20%.
- Operated forklifts and other warehouse equipment to move and organize stock safely.
- Collaborated with team members to ensure orders were processed and shipped on time.

Stocking Associate | XYZ Retail | March 2020 – December 2021
- Managed inventory levels and replenished products on shelves based on sales demand.
- Ensured all products were labeled correctly and placed in the correct aisles.
- Assisted with maintaining store organization and cleanliness to improve customer experience.
- Helped customers with product inquiries and directed them to relevant sections of the store.

5 Sample Interview Preparation Questions for Inventory Stockers

Preparing for an interview is essential to showcasing your skills and qualifications. Below are five sample questions commonly asked during inventory stocker interviews, along with tips for answering them effectively:

1. What experience do you have with inventory management systems?

Answer: “I have hands-on experience using software such as SAP and Oracle for inventory management. I have successfully tracked product levels, recorded data accurately, and ensured timely reorders for the warehouse.”

2. How do you prioritize your tasks when dealing with multiple shipments?

Answer: “I prioritize by evaluating deadlines, the urgency of each shipment, and space availability. I make sure to communicate with my team to delegate tasks efficiently.”

3. How would you handle a situation where stock is missing or damaged?

Answer: “I would immediately report the issue to my supervisor, investigate any discrepancies, and ensure that inventory records are updated. I would also assist in identifying how the damage or loss occurred to prevent future incidents.”

4. Can you describe a time when you had to deal with a difficult situation at work?

Answer: “There was an instance when a shipment arrived late. I quickly rearranged the schedule to accommodate the delayed shipment while ensuring that other operations continued smoothly without disruption.”

5. How do you ensure accuracy in inventory counts?

Answer: “I double-check all items during stock-taking and follow a systematic approach to maintain consistency. I also cross-reference quantities with the inventory management system to ensure there are no discrepancies.”
